That happened because iproto thread sent two requests to TX thread at disconnect: - Close the session and run its on disconnect triggers; - If all requests are handled, destroy the session. When a connection is idle, all requests are handled, so both these requests are sent. If the first one yielded in TX thread, the second one arrived and destroyed the session right under the feet of the first one. This can be solved in two ways - in TX thread, and in iproto thread. TX thread solution (which is chosen in the patch): add a flag which says whether disconnect is processed by TX. When destroy request arrives, it checks the flag. If disconnect is not done, the destroy request waits on a condition variable until it is. The solution is simple, but adds new members to iproto_connection struct, and requires lots of commenting. Iproto thread solution (alternative): just don't send destroy request until disconnect returns back to iproto thread.
